This is a major change in the French football broadcasting landscape. Omar Da Fonseca is leaving beIN Sports after 14 years with the channel and joining Disney+, where he will continue to commentate on La Liga. According to L'Équipe , the 66-year-old Argentinian pundit will form a new duo with Julien Brun, who has also been recruited by the platform.

Omar Da Fonseca turns the page on beIN Sports after 14 years

A key figure at beIN Sports since its launch in France in 2012, Omar Da Fonseca had become one of the most recognizable voices in Spanish football. His enthusiasm, his expressions, and his partnership with Benjamin Da Silva had been a constant presence during the biggest La Liga matches for over a decade. His departure comes at a time when beIN Sports is also losing the rights to the Spanish Championship. Starting with the 2026-2027 season, Disney+ and DAZN will both broadcast all La Liga matches in France, as part of a three-season agreement running until 2028-2029. Omar Da Fonseca is therefore not leaving his favorite league. He is simply switching broadcasters and will continue his La Liga commentary on ESPN via Disney+.

A new duo with Julien Brun

To partner Omar Da Fonseca, Disney+ has chosen Julien Brun, 48. The journalist has worked for beIN Sports, Prime Video, and DAZN. Having been without a regular commentary position last season, he returned to the microphone this summer on M6 for the 2026 World Cup, where he commentated on several matches alongside Samuel Umtiti. The Julien Brun-Omar Da Fonseca duo will be in charge of the main matches of the Spanish Championship on the platform. Their first match is scheduled for Saturday, August 15 at 19:30 p.m., with Alavés vs. Getafe, the opening match of the season.

All 380 La Liga matches available on Disney+

Disney+ has acquired the rights to broadcast all 380 La Liga matches each season in France, from 2026-2027 to 2028-2029. The matches will be shown live on ESPN within Disney+, with French commentary and at no extra cost to subscribers of the platform. The biggest matches will be commentated by Julien Brun and Omar Da Fonseca. For the other matches, Disney+ will use several journalists, including Alban Lepoivre, who is scheduled to commentate on the Sevilla-Rayo Vallecano match on Saturday evening. Real Madrid will begin their La Liga season on August 26 against Real Sociedad, while FC Barcelona will face Athletic Bilbao on August 27.

La Liga changes broadcasters, Da Fonseca remains on the microphone

Omar Da Fonseca's departure primarily marks the end of a long history with beIN Sports. For 14 years, the pundit was associated with the channel's coverage of Spanish football. With La Liga also leaving beIN Sports , Da Fonseca will follow the Spanish league with its new broadcaster. For Disney+, his signing allows them to immediately acquire a personality closely associated with La Liga in France. Alongside Julien Brun, Omar Da Fonseca will continue to commentate on Real Madrid, FC Barcelona, ​​Atlético de Madrid, and other major Spanish matches, but now under the Disney+ banner.
